I am from Malaysia and will be on holidays in England from 10th to 1st December 2009. My kids are from 12 to 5 years old. We are thinking of renting a car to visit cities in England. Can you suggest suitable itinerary and places to visit especially for children. Thank you

Answer
Hello,

I am a bit unclear how many days you will be in England...did you mean 1st through 10th December?  I will assume that is correct and you will be in England for 9 or 10 days.

If your family has not visited the United Kingdom before, then you may wish to spend a significant portion of that time in London since it has so many sights and activities, especially for family groups.  You do NOT need a car for London--the public transportation system is very good and driving and parking in the city is a challenge, even for Londoners.  

Keep in mind that daylight hours are limited in December, so you need to plan your itinerary accordingly, both for driving and sightseeing.  

You could easily spend your entire visit in London, adding daytrips outside the city to nearby locations such as Windsor, Hampton Court, Greenwich, etc.  All of these can be reached by train from central London in 30-40 min¨tes.  Beyond London, I suggest you consider York, Bath, Cambridge, and Oxford as possible places to visit.  Again, if you intend to visit cities, you could drive or you could take a train.

York is a fine place to spend 2 days...this walled city has a wonderful cathedral, a Viking museum, and a fine transport museum (the latter a favorites with children).  Bath has the ancient Roman baths, fine architecture, etc.  Oxford and Cambridge are both university towns with a number of interesting sights.  You  could also consider heading further north to Edinburgh (about 4 hours by train) and seeing a bit of Scotland.  (Daylight hours are even shorter as you head north, and the weather can be nasty too).
